Biology of Bryophytes and Ferns
Biologie der Moose und Farne
Last Updated: 2026-02-05 16:30:52
Abstract
Bryophytes: basic knowledge on the morphology, ecology, biogeography and endangerment of byrophytes; knowledge of common species; skills in the determination of bryophytes; field trip.Ferns: basic knowledge on the life cycle, morphology, evolution and ecology of ferns; identification of Swiss ferns; field trips.
Objective
Bryophytes: basic knowledge on the morphology, ecology, biogeography and endangerment of byrophytes; knowledge of common species; skills in the determination of bryophytes. Ferns: basic knowledge on the life cycle, morphology, evolution and ecology of ferns; identification of Swiss ferns.
Content
Bryophytes: Systematics and morphology of hornworts, liverworts and mosses and additional topics such as ecology, biogeography, diversity and endangerment of bryophytes; one full-day field trip. Ferns: Life cycle and morphology; evolutionary groups of ferns including horsetails and lycopods; mating systems, phylogeny and evolutionary processes; ecology; full-day and half-day field trips.
